My friend Paul is converting his tuned vauxhall back to standard and has his reliable faster engine for sale.

 

Vauxhall 2.O 16v engine with full dry sump system:

The engine would cost about £6500 to build today according to Nobles (Paul has previous invoices to this effect) .

 

It is around 230 bhp carb`s with steel rods, accralite pistons , MEB 967I Computer etc ...and has only done around 2000 miles since last refreshed ( Noble Motorsport can verify everything ; ) .....also have dyno printout .
